What You Need to Know About Vanderbilt University

Ivy Central

Vanderbilt University’s first-year retention rate is 97%. The College of Arts and Science is the largest school at Vanderbilt, offering more than 100 majors and minors across 70+ fields of study from English to Economics, Climate Studies to Chemistry, and Philosophy to Physics. The 4-year graduation rate is 88.76%.

The Claremont Colleges: Pitzer College

Ivy Central

Pitzer College’s first-year retention rate is 93%. A very interesting aspect of Pitzer College is that many courses are co-taught by two professors of different fields of study. Academics Majors and Minors At Pitzer College, field groups (similar to a discipline or department) organize major requirements and courses.
